Oral care comprises of few basic activities that we carry out on daily basis!
Simple things as brushing and flossing effectively can increase your oral health tremendously.

Brushing:

Choosing the right kind of toothbrush and toothpaste is vital for your oral care, usually a soft-headed toothbrush is recommended to remove plaque and to keep tooth clean!

It is also advisable to use a small-headed toothbrush as it can reach all parts of mouth easily making cleaning easy and more effective!

It is recommended to brush twice daily for about 2 minutes, we tend to brush way less amount of time usually.

Choosing right toothpaste is equally important for healthy teeth, please consult your dental professional to advise you the right toothpaste for you.

Brushing tips:

  • Use a 45 degree angle to brush your teeth

  • Brush top and bottom teeth both inside and out

  • Use appropriate mouthwashes to compliment brushing

  • Rinse your mouth every time you eat food

  • Brush twice daily without fail

Flossing:

Flossing tips:

Although we can brush outside and inside surfaces of the teeth, we cannot brush the surface between the teeth effectively, it can only be cleaned by flossing.

There are various flossing options are available now including flossing tape, interdental brushes and toothpick floss etc. chose the best suited option and floss every night without fail. Remember flossing is the only way you can clean the surface between the teeth.

Fluoride:

Fluoride is a type of mineral naturally present in all kind of waters, it is know that fluoride helps reducing cavities and tooth decay! Fluoride gets absorbed in to the enamel and helps the enamel by replenishing the lost calcium and phosphorous.

This helps your teeth to remain hard and strong!
